WebbTo update the k3s cluster you can utilize the same systemd unit by renaming the k3s binary and restarting the unit, for example to update the worker nodes: # mv /usr/local/bin/k3s /usr/local/bin/k3s_OLD # systemctl restart install-rancher-k3s-worker.service # systemctl reboot WebbIf nodes are assigned dynamic IPs and the IP changes (e.g. in AWS), you must modify the --node-external-ip parameter to reflect the new IP.
